What is a Certified Window Installer?
Certified window installers are professionals who have actually gone through extensive training and accreditation procedures to ensure they have the requisite understanding and skills for the task. They are typically affiliated with professional companies that set requirements for installation practices, materials, and techniques.

Employing certified window installers provides numerous benefits that go beyond simply making sure a task well done. Here are some crucial factors to seek out certified professionals:
1. Proficiency and Knowledge
Certified installers have undergone thorough training. They recognize with the most recent installation techniques, tools, and products. This expertise reduces the danger of installation errors that might lead to expensive repairs down the line.
2. Service warranty Protection
The majority of producers need windows to be installed by certified professionals for guarantees to remain valid. Failing to utilize certified installers might void the warranty, positioning the monetary problem of repairs or replacements squarely on the house owner.
3. Compliance with Regulations
Window installation frequently comes with different structure codes and regulations. Certified installers are typically knowledgeable about these codes and make sure that all installations comply, lowering the threat of fines or required corrections later on.
4. Increased Energy Efficiency
Proper installation assists ensure windows operate effectively, promoting better insulation and energy performance. This can result in lower utility costs and enhanced convenience within the home.
5. Improved Aesthetics
Windows are a centerpiece of any home's exterior. An improperly installed Reliable Window Installers can result in gaps, leakages, and an unequal look. Certified installers have the skills to make sure that windows are set up correctly and look attractive.
What to Look for in a Certified Window Installer
When searching for the right certified window installer, consider the following requirements:
Experience: Look for installers with a tested track record in your area.Recommendations and Reviews: Ask for recommendations or read online reviews to determine the installer's reliability and work quality.Licenses and Insurance: Ensure they have the required licenses to operate in your location and sufficient insurance coverage for liability defense.Written Estimates: A certified installer ought to offer a comprehensive written estimate before starting work, covering both labor and materials.Post-Installation Support: Inquire about the guarantee and services offered after installation. A reputable installer needs to offer assistance for the products they've set up.FAQ - Certified Window Installers
